New Delhi: 165 new cases of corona infection have been registered in the country's capital Delhi on Friday. The rate of infection has come down to 0.22 per cent and 14 patients have lost their lives in these 24 hours. The Delhi government has examined 76,480 samples in 24 hours. On Friday, 260 patients recovered and returned home.

According to an official report, the number of patients active in Delhi has now come down to 2445 and there are 698 patients who are being treated in solitary confinement at home. Similarly, 1486 patients are being treated in the hospital, 85 in covid care centre and 11 in covid health centre. The Delhi Government has conducted 53724 RTPCR and 22756 antigen tests in 24 hours. At present, there are a total of 5452 sealed areas within Delhi. The corona related rules are being strictly followed in these areas.

A total of 1432033 cases of corona infection have been registered in Delhi so far. Out of these patients, 1404688 have recovered and gone back home and the disease has so far claimed 24900 patients. The corona infection rate has been reported at 6.94 and mortality at 1.74 per cent so far.
